![](/img/trans.png)
[英]calculation the difference for same column for the specific rows in Spotfire
[英]Spotfire - Partition by column and number rows in partition consecutively
我将一个简单的ID列表导入了Spotfire。 我想创建一个具有相同ID的连续数字的计算列。 每个ID的编号应从1开始。
这是一个例子:
ID
一种
一种
一种
乙
乙
C
结果应如下所示:
身份证号
A 1
A2
A 3
B 1
B 2
C 1
我在Stackoverflow中搜索了类似的问题,并尝试将先前的功能与层次结构结合使用。 我还查看了帮助文件。 到目前为止,我还没有成功。
非常感谢您的帮助。 如果我错过了类似的问题,或者我的问题需要澄清(这是我在StackOverflow上的第一个问题),请告诉我。
预先非常感谢您,
阿德里安
通过将RowId()
添加为称为[row]
的计算列,然后通过[NUMBER]
Count([ID]) over (Intersect(AllPrevious([row]),[ID]))
来计算[NUMBER]
作为Count([ID]) over (Intersect(AllPrevious([row]),[ID]))
我能够做到这一点。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.